Highlights/Qualifications

Design, development, and improvement of mechanical assemblies used in the actuator product lines. This role involves 3D modeling, testing, and close collaboration with cross-functional teams to ensure our actuators deliver reliable and precise motion. This high-profile role focuses on mechanical assemblies, improving product performance, and supporting production with advanced troubleshooting and testing.

  • Design and develop mechanical components, assemblies, and mechanisms used in electro-mechanical actuator systems.
  • Create 3D CAD models, detailed drawings, and engineering documentation.
  • Perform tolerance stack-ups, material selections, and engineering analyses to ensure robust mechanical performance.
  • Support prototype builds, testing, and design validation activities, including data analysis and reporting.
  • Troubleshoot mechanical issues in prototypes and production units, driving root cause analysis and corrective actions.
  • Collaborate with electrical engineering, manufacturing, and quality to integrate mechanical designs into complete systems.
  • Support process improvements aimed at manufacturability, cost reduction, and product durability.
  • Participate in supplier discussions, reviewing feasibility and production readiness of new or revised components.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ical Engineering or a closely related field.
  • 5+ years of experience in mechanical design or product development, ideally with electromechanical, actuator, or motion-control products.
  • Strong proficiency in 3D CAD (SolidWorks preferred) and mechanical drawings with GD&T.
  • Solid understanding of mechanical systems, including gears, bearings, linear motion components, and load analysis.
  • Experience with mechanical testing, measurement tools, and performance validation.
  • Ability to collaborate effectively across engineering, manufacturing, and supply chain teams.
  • Strong analytical, documentation, and problem-solving skills.
  • Hands‑on approach to prototype evaluation and troubleshooting.
Additional Valued Skills for this Position:
  • Background in actuator technology or machinery that incorporates motors, gearing, or motion control.
  • Familiarity with FEA tools or simulation software.
  • Experience with DFM/DFA and manufacturing processes such as machining, molding, or casting.
  • Exposure to reliability engineering, FMEA, or structured problem‑solving methods.
